Key variables that most affect the final quote for metal building homes
Site access and terrain can add trucking, crane time, and foundation complexity, often adding tens of thousands in hilly or remote areas. System type and insulation level drive material costs directly: a full-assembly modular system with premium insulation can add $20–$40 per sq ft versus a basic shell.
Concrete foundation choices and how they shift the price
Foundations commonly range from a slab-on-grade to full basement integration. For a 1,800 sq ft home, a slab may cost around $8,000–$18,000, while a crawlspace or full basement can push to $25,000–$60,000 depending on depth, reinforcing, and drainage considerations. Assumptions: standard 4-inch slab, moderate rebar, typical soil conditions.

Delivery, crane, and installation time drivers you should plan for
Delivery fees and crane use commonly add $3,000–$12,000, depending on lot access and the number of large panels. Installation time commonly spans 4–8 weeks for shell and 6–14 weeks for full interior completion in standard markets. Assumptions: normal weather, standard crew size.
Materials and equipment that most influence the quote
Metal cladding, insulation type (spray foam vs batt), and interior finishes are the largest per-square-foot cost drivers after the shell. For a 2,000 sq ft home, choosing higher R-value insulation and premium interior finishes can add roughly $15,000–$40,000 above a mid-range option. Assumptions: standard fastening systems, 26-gauge panels, mid-range drywall and flooring.
Labor dynamics: crew size, hours, and regional rates
Most metal home builds use a small crew over several weeks. A 2,000 sq ft project might require a 4–8 person crew with total labor hours around 400–800, translating to $16,000–$60,000 in labor depending on local rates. Assumptions: typical union/non-union mix, standard overtime practices.

Ownership considerations that affect long-term cost
Energy efficiency, maintenance needs, and warranty terms influence long-run expenses. A higher upfront insulation level can reduce monthly utility bills by 10–25% over the first decade, offsetting higher initial costs. Assumptions: average local utility rates, standard warranty terms.
